Request to drop charges against Ms Mariam Sukhudyan

We are writing to you to express our concern that the Erebouni Criminal Investigation Department has charged Ms Mariam Sukhudyan, an environmental and civic activist, with false denunciation (article 333, paragraph 2 of the Criminal Code of Armenia), and request that the charges against her are dropped.
The charges were made after a group of young volunteers, including Ms Sukhudyan, publicly highlighted the problems at the Noubarashen boarding school N11 for children with special needs in Yerevan, including the poor level of education, poor food, the use of physical punishment, and sexual assault of female pupils.
It is unacceptable that those who sought to highlight these problems have been punished, instead of a thorough and impartial investigation of the issues being carried out.
Some of us have had a chance to meet Ms Sukhudyan in person and to learn about her activities, and we believe that active participation in improving social and environmental problems is something that should be encouraged, not punished.
We request from Armenian state institutions to conduct a full and fair investigation, aimed at addressing the problems in Noubarashen boarding school N11, not at calling into question the motivations of those who raised the issues. We further call on you to ensure that the school in question, as well as other schools, are regularly monitored to ensure an adequate level of education, food, sanitary conditions and the full protection of pupils personal safety and rights.
We appeal to international organizations located inside our country as well as abroad to use their mandate and leverage to ensure protection of human rights and access to justice in Armenia.
